Have you ever stopped to contemplate how simple acts of appreciation can transform your everyday love? It’s easy to get caught up in the routine and overlook the small things that make your relationship special. But intentionally practicing gratitude expressions and engaging in appreciative gestures can profoundly deepen your connection. When you notice and acknowledge your partner’s efforts, it sends a powerful message that you see and value them. These small acts don’t require grand gestures; instead, they thrive in everyday moments — a genuine “thank you” for a kind deed, a warm smile, or a simple compliment. These acts of appreciation foster a positive cycle where kindness and acknowledgment become natural parts of your relationship.
Expressing gratitude isn’t just about saying “thanks” once in a while. It’s about making it a conscious habit. When you regularly highlight what you appreciate about your partner, you reinforce their importance in your life. For example, noticing how they handle a stressful day and telling them how much you admire their resilience, or thanking them for preparing dinner, can make a huge difference. These gratitude expressions make your partner feel seen and appreciated, which strengthens your emotional bond. At the same time, appreciative gestures—like leaving a thoughtful note or offering a reassuring hug—serve as tangible reminders of your love and appreciation. It’s these small, consistent acts that create a foundation of mutual respect and affection.
Incorporating appreciation into your daily routine doesn’t mean grand displays of affection every day, but rather intentional acts that show you care. When you focus on the positive qualities and efforts of your partner, it shifts the focus from frustrations or unmet expectations to acknowledgment and admiration. Over time, this encourages a more optimistic outlook on your relationship. Your partner begins to feel more secure, loved, and motivated to reciprocate those gestures. Appreciation acts as a catalyst that nurtures trust and intimacy, making your love more resilient to challenges. How Can I Show Appreciation When My Partner Is Upset?
When your partner is upset, you can show appreciation by practicing active listening—give them your full attention and avoid interrupting. Offer emotional validation by acknowledging their feelings without judgment, saying things like, “I understand why you’re upset.” This shows you value their emotions. Small gestures, like a gentle touch or reassuring words, also demonstrate you care, helping them feel appreciated and understood during tough moments.

How Do Cultural Differences Affect Expressions of Appreciation?
Cultural differences profoundly influence how you express appreciation, with studies showing that emotional expression varies greatly worldwide. In some cultures, direct verbal appreciation is common, while others favor subtle gestures or acts of service. Your cultural background shapes your style of cultural communication, affecting how you show and interpret appreciation. Recognizing these differences helps you better understand your partner’s needs and fosters deeper emotional connection in your relationship.
What Are Common Mistakes to Avoid When Showing Appreciation?
When showing appreciation, avoid neglecting genuine recognition gestures and gratitude expressions. Don’t overlook small acts that matter, like saying “thank you” sincerely or giving thoughtful gestures. Avoid overdoing it or making appreciation seem obligatory, as it can feel insincere. Be specific in your recognition, and guarantee your gratitude feels heartfelt. This way, your partner feels truly valued, strengthening your bond through authentic appreciation.
